Подтвердить что ты не робот

Повышение производительности Coroutines: симметричное против асимметричного

Глядя на страницу производительности , симметричные сопрограммы кажутся значительно дешевле, чем асимметричные, примерно в 50 раз. Это кажется удивительным, поскольку симметричные сопрограммы, как представляется, обеспечивают более общую абстракцию. Есть ли какая-то функциональность в асимметричных сопрограммах, которая оправдывает эту стоимость?

Я также должен добавить, что в контексте асимметричных сопрограмм стоимость строительства составляет около 500x стоимости коммутатора контекста, поэтому он может быть легко узким местом в приложении.

4b9b3361